首页前端开发JavaScriptjavascript 获取元素属性

javascript 获取元素属性

时间2023-11-12 12:10:03发布访客分类JavaScript浏览1087
导读:JavaScript 是一种前端开发常用的编程语言,它可以为网页增加交互性和动态性。 在 JavaScript 中,对于如何获取元素属性值,是我们在处理 DOM 时需要了解的基础。一般来说,获取元素属性值,我们需要使用原生(native)方...
JavaScript 是一种前端开发常用的编程语言,它可以为网页增加交互性和动态性。 在 JavaScript 中,对于如何获取元素属性值,是我们在处理 DOM 时需要了解的基础。一般来说,获取元素属性值,我们需要使用原生(native)方法或框架提供的方法。比如,在原生 JavaScript 中,可以通过 getElementById() 或 getAttribute() 方法获取 DOM 元素的 ID 属性和自定义属性。举个例子,假设我们有一个段落元素是这样的:
p id="myP" class="red" data-info="Some additional text">
    This is a paragraph./p>
    
可以使用 JavaScript 来获取这个段落元素的 id 属性如下:
var myParagraph = document.getElementById("myP");
     var myId = myParagraph.id;
     console.log(myId);
     // 输出:myP
还可以使用 getAttribute() 方法获取 data-info 属性:
var myDataVal = myParagraph.getAttribute("data-info");
     console.log(myDataVal);
     // 输出:Some additional text
但是,如果我们使用像 jQuery 这样的 JavaScript 框架,就可以更方便地获取元素属性值。比如,在 jQuery 中,可以使用 $() 或 .attr() 方法来获取元素属性值。例如,我们可以使用 $() 函数来选择先前的段落元素并获取其 data-info 属性:
var myParagraph = $("#myP");
     var myDataVal = myParagraph.attr("data-info");
     console.log(myDataVal);
     // 输出:Some additional text
同样地,可以使用 .attr() 方法获取 id 属性:
var myId = myParagraph.attr("id");
     console.log(myId);
     // 输出:myP
总之,无论是原生 JavaScript 还是框架,获取元素属性值是非常重要和使用频繁的。熟悉获取元素属性值的方法可以让我们更好地处理 DOM,在开发过程中更加得心应手。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: javascript 获取元素属性
本文地址: https://pptw.com/jishu/535938.html
javascript 获取天气 javascript 获取表格数据

游客 回复需填写必要信息